What’s driving this perceived shift? Several scientifically grounded variables play a role. First, temperature variations significantly impact battery efficiency—cold weather can reduce range by 20–30%, and even mild chill elevates energy demand for heating and battery chemical reactions. Second, driving behavior has adapted: increased use of climate control, frequent acceleration, and regenerative braking patterns differ from pre-EV habits, altering energy consumption dynamically. Third, updated software optimizations over time may affect power management differently across vehicle iterations. Finally, real-world factors like road load, terrain gradients, and tire pressure changes contribute to range variability independent of the vehicle itself. These elements, when combined with typical driving contexts, explain the range differences reported by users—without indicating design or build problems.
